<p>Pepper fruit (Piper nigrum L.) is an agricultural commodity whose market value strongly depends on its ripeness level at harvest. Ripeness determination, which is still commonly performed through visual observation, tends to be inaccurate and subjective. This study aims to classify the ripeness level of pepper fruit based on skin color using an ensemble learning approach. The dataset consists of 1,996 pepper fruit images categorized into four ripeness levels unripe, semi ripe, ripe, and overripe. Color features were extracted from the HSV color model using color moment statistics including mean, standard deviation, and skewness. Random Forest and XGBoost models were combined using a soft voting method. The results show that the ensemble model achieved 98.25% accuracy, 98.30% precision, 98.27% recall, and 98.26% F1-score. <p class="Style7" style="margin: 0cm 43.95pt 6.0pt 36.0pt;"><span lang="IN">This study presents a classification model for detecting diseases in patchouli (Pogostemon cablin Benth) leaves using image processing techniques. The method combines Grey Level Co-occurrence Matrix (GLCM) for texture feature extraction and Support Vector Machine (SVM) for classification, optimised using the Particle Swarm Optimisation (PSO) algorithm. A total of 2,080 leaf images were collected and categorized into four classes: healthy, leaf spot, yellowing, and mosaic. Each image was augmented and converted to grayscale to enhance the dataset and reduce computational complexity. Four GLCM features—contrast, correlation, energy, and homogeneity—were extracted to represent leaf textures. The classification model achieved an accuracy of <strong>89.74%</strong> using SVM alone, and improved to <strong>97.12%</strong> when optimized with PSO. <p class="Style7" style="margin: 0cm 43.85pt 6.0pt 36.0pt;"><span lang="EN-US">Manual analysis of large-scale and unstructured textual feedback data is often inefficient and subjective, thereby hindering data-driven decision-making. This study aims to design and implement an integrated analytical workflow to automatically filter, cluster, and classify feedback data consisting of criticisms and suggestions. The research employs a hybrid approach that begins with TF-IDF-based data filtering, followed by dimensionality reduction using Latent Semantic Analysis (LSA), and topic clustering through K-Means clustering optimized with the Silhouette Score. The resulting cluster labels are then used as training data to build a Multinomial Naive Bayes classification model. The results show that this workflow successfully identified two main thematic clusters, namely "Criticism and Expectations" and "Suggestions and Compliments", and the classification model achieved an overall accuracy of 91%. Although class imbalance affected the recall of the minority class (47%), the model demonstrated high precision (95%) for that class. <p class="Style7" style="text-indent: 34.9pt; margin: 0cm 43.85pt 6.0pt 36.0pt;"><span lang="EN-US">Water consumption forecasting is a crucial aspect of efficient water resource management, particularly in urban areas with increasing demand. This study aims to predict the monthly water usage volume at the PDAM of Tamalate District using the Autoregressive Integrated Moving Average (ARIMA) method. The dataset consists of historical water usage data from January 2022 to December 2024, totaling 36 monthly observations. The analysis process includes stationarity testing using the Augmented Dickey-Fuller (ADF) test, model parameter identification through ACF and PACF plots, and performance evaluation using MAE, RMSE, and MAPE metrics. The results show that the best-performing model is ARIMA, which demonstrates high prediction accuracy, with a MAE of 26,049.80 m³, RMSE of 37,459.00 m³, and MAPE of 4.12%. This model is capable of generating predictions close to actual values and can be relied upon as a basis for PDAM’s water distribution planning. <p class="Style7" style="margin: 0cm 43.85pt 6.0pt 36.0pt;"><span lang="EN-US">The evaluation of government training programs is often hindered by manual analysis of unstructured qualitative feedback, making the process inefficient and subjective. This study aims to implement and evaluate a sentiment classification model using a hybrid Lexicon-Based and Support Vector Machine approach to analyze participants’ perceptions of the Vocational School Graduate Academy training organized by BBPSDMP Kominfo Makassar, as well as to compare the performance of a standard SVM model with a model optimized using Particle Swarm Optimization. This quantitative research employs 2,313 unstructured review data, which undergo text preprocessing, initial lexicon-based labeling, and TF-IDF feature extraction before being classified using an SVM with an RBF kernel. The results show that the SVM model optimized with PSO consistently outperforms the standard model across all four evaluation aspects, with the most significant accuracy improvement observed in the instructor category from 84.71% to 89.02% and in the assessor category reaching 91.46%. PSO optimization has proven effective in enhancing the model’s ability to identify negative sentiments, which represent the minority class. <p> </p> <p> </p> <p class="Style7" style="margin: 0cm 43.85pt 6.0pt 36.0pt;"><span lang="EN-US">Firefighting operations in Medan City still face significant challenges in locating and monitoring the condition of fire Hydrants: out of 118 Hydrant points, only 23 are documented as operational and just 6 are fully functional. This study aims to design and implement a web‑based WebGIS for the fastest route navigation to the nearest Hydrant and real‑time Hydrant condition Monitoring, employing an iterative Prototype methodology. The system is built using PHP & MySQL on the backend, Leaflet.js for interactive mapping and Routing, and AJAX for seamless data Updates. Functional testing (black‑box) confirms all modules Admin Login, Hydrant CRUD, “Nearest Hydrant” Routing, status Updates, and map Refresh operate as expected with average AJAX response times of 0.3 - 0.5 seconds and map load times under 1.5 seconds for 200 points. Field accuracy tests reveal a coordinate deviation of ± 3 meters, while Hydrant search time is reduced from an average of 2 minutes manually to approximately 15 seconds digitally. The responsive interface supports both desktop and mobile access, optimally serving Admin and Field Officer needs. <p class="Style7" style="margin: 0in 43.85pt 6.0pt .5in;">This research addresses the challenge of retrieving Qur’anic verses in Latin transliteration, which is hindered by the absence of a standardized orthography, leading to diverse spelling variations. The study aims to design and implement a hybrid information retrieval system that integrates Fuzzy Jaro-Winkler for lexical similarity and Cosine Similarity on fine-tuned DistilBERT embeddings for semantic relevance. The system workflow begins with preprocessing and normalization of the dataset, followed by initial candidate selection using Jaro-Winkler, and final reranking through semantic similarity scoring. Evaluation was conducted using black-box testing across scenarios including ideal queries, spelling variations, incomplete queries, and varying query lengths. Results show high accuracy for ideal (96%) and varied spelling queries (92%), with performance improving as query length increases, reaching 96% for four-word queries. The hybrid approach effectively bridges lexical and semantic gaps, outperforming single-method baselines, and demonstrates robustness in handling non-standard transliteration in Qur’anic text retrieval.</p>Gempar Perkasa TahirEmil Agusalim Habi TalibFahrim Irhamna Rachman

<p class="Style7" style="margin: 0cm 43.85pt 6.0pt 36.0pt;"><span lang="EN-US">This paper presents the implementation of a hybrid approach for face recognition attendance systems, combining Convolutional Neural Network (CNN), facial landmark detection, and liveness detection. The CNN model extracts facial features for identity recognition, while facial landmark detection captures dynamic movements such as eye blinking and mouth motion. Liveness detection ensures system robustness against spoofing attempts including photo and video replay. The system was developed using Python with OpenCV, MediaPipe, and TensorFlow, and tested under multiple spoofing scenarios. Results show a detection accuracy of 95.5%, with real-time performance and resilience against common spoofing threats.</span></p>Andi Muhammad Akbar DBMuhammad FaisalMuhyiddin AM Hayat
